Latest Patents
Nema's latest patents showcase his innovative approaches in the field. The first patent focuses on "Methods of preserving the biological activity of ribonucleic acids," which details a method for maintaining the biological functions of double-stranded RNA (dsRNA) within cells. This technique leverages protein or amine cross-linking agents or acids to enhance gene expression control in target organisms.
His second patent is dedicated to "Gene silencing," which introduces methods for efficiently delivering polynucleotides to subterranean plant pests. This invention aims to reduce the adherence of polynucleotide compositions to soil, enhancing their effectiveness through the use of quenching agents that neutralize positively charged residues, combined with a cationic polymer and polynucleotides.
